Emerging Technologies Influencing Casting Processes in 2025

As we look ahead to 2025, several emerging technologies are poised to reshape the casting industry, enhancing efficiency, quality, and sustainability. One notable trend is the integration of automation and robotics into the casting process. Automated systems can significantly reduce labor costs and minimize human error, making it easier to maintain high production standards. This shift not only streamlines operations but also allows manufacturers to focus on more complex tasks that require human oversight.

Furthermore, advancements in materials science are leading to the development of new alloys and composites that offer improved performance characteristics. These innovations enable the production of lighter, stronger, and more durable casting parts, which are essential for industries such as automotive and aerospace.

Additionally, digital technologies like artificial intelligence and machine learning are being utilized to optimize casting designs and processes, predicting outcomes and identifying potential issues before they arise. As we embrace these emerging technologies, the casting industry will become more agile and responsive to global demands, setting the stage for a transformative decade ahead.

Regional Trends in Casting Part Demand and Supply Chains

In 2025, the landscape of casting parts demand and supply chains is poised for significant transformation, driven by regional trends that reflect both local and global market dynamics. According to a recent report by Smithers Pira, the casting market is projected to reach $159 billion by 2025 with Asia-Pacific leading the way, attributed to the booming automotive and aerospace industries. Countries like China and India are not only expanding their manufacturing capacities but also innovating in casting technologies, resulting in increased demand for high-quality, lightweight components.

Europe, on the other hand, is witnessing a shift towards sustainable and eco-friendly practices. The European Foundry Association reports that nearly 70% of European foundries are investing in green technologies, reflecting a growing consumer preference for sustainable products. This trend is expected to reshape supply chains as sourcing strategies increasingly prioritize suppliers who adhere to environmental standards.

**Tip: To stay competitive, manufacturers should focus on building strong relationships with suppliers in high-demand regions while also keeping an eye on sustainability practices.**

In North America, an increase in infrastructure projects is driving the demand for durable casting parts, particularly in the construction sector. The latest data from the American Foundry Society indicates that investments in construction-related casting applications are expected to rise by 15% over the next three years.

Navigating Compliance and Quality Standards in Global Sourcing

In today's interconnected world, navigating compliance and quality standards in global sourcing for casting parts is more crucial than ever. Businesses must enhance their understanding of local regulations, international standards, and industry-specific requirements. This ensures not only adherence to legal frameworks but also fosters trust and transparency within supply chains. For instance, manufacturers must comply with stringent quality certifications such as ISO and ASTM, which mandate consistent quality control and testing protocols to guarantee the reliability of casting components.

Moreover, as companies source casting parts from diverse geographical locations, understanding and managing quality variations can pose significant challenges. It becomes essential to conduct thorough audits of suppliers and establish comprehensive quality assurance practices. Adopting advanced technologies such as blockchain can facilitate real-time tracking of compliance and quality metrics, thereby helping companies mitigate risks and enhance accountability. As industry trends evolve, embracing these strategies will empower organizations to source high-quality casting parts efficiently while complying with the necessary standards across global markets.
